Why Compliance Training Is Critical in Manufacturing
Manufacturers face unique risks and regulations, including:
Workplace Safety: Preventing injuries, fatalities, and OSHA violations
Environmental Compliance: Managing emissions, waste, and hazardous materials
Product and Quality Standards: Ensuring ISO and industry certification requirements are met
Global Supply Chain Risk: Meeting export, import, and environmental mandates
In this industry, compliance training isn’t just about avoiding fines—it protects workers, keeps production running, and maintains the licenses and certifications required to operate.
Key Manufacturing Compliance Regulations
As an LMS Portals partner, targeting manufacturing and industrial compliance allows you to serve clients in areas like:
OSHA General Industry Standards (U.S.)
Hazard Communication (HazCom) and GHS Labeling
Lockout/Tagout (LOTO) for Machine Safety
EPA Regulations for Environmental Protection (U.S.)
ISO 9001 (Quality Management) and ISO 14001 (Environmental Management)
REACH and RoHS (EU Chemical and Material Safety)
DOT and HAZMAT Handling for manufacturers shipping hazardous goods
